Unifi Dnsmasq As Dhcp Server, Readers will learn how to enable the Dn

Unifi Dnsmasq As Dhcp Server, Readers will learn how to enable the Dnsmasq feature on the EdgeRouter's DHCP server. conf files as additional config files and *. 9. SSH into the USG and enter configuration mode, remember to turn on ssh first if you've not done that already! 2. conf configuration (USG>WAN>DNS in the Unifi controller) and allow the USG to generate the correct dnsmasq docker-compose up UniFi clients with DNS-compatible aliases will be written to /etc/dnsmasq. DNS server: dnsmasq I’m using dnsmasq for my DHCP server If you’re using a UniFi Security Gateway sooner or later you’re going to run into an issue with DNS entries registered during the DHCP process. A dnsmasq being populated by aliases/name overrides made in a UniFi controller - wicol/unifi-dns If you’re using a dedicated internal DNS server—such as for Active Directory—you can configure UniFi to direct clients to it automatically via DHCP: Go to Settings Apply Changes: After entering your preferred DNS servers, click on 'Save' to apply the changes. Knowledge of the Command Line Interface (CLI) and basic networking knowledge is required. The example below shows how to use an alternative default gateway (3), DNS (6) and NTP (42) servers, Ubiquiti (unifi devices) uses option 43 (sub-option 1) to send the IP address of the unifi controller to devices to enable L3 adoption. Install a DNS Server: Install a DNS server software like BIND on a local machine or server. Applicable to the v1. The DNS server settings I use dnsmasq as my DHCP and DNS server for IPv4 devices. 0 EdgeOS firmware and higher on all EdgeRouter Set DNS settings in your UniFi Controller and gateway to improve speed, stability, and device adoption across your network. (Internal, dnsmasq) DNS server presented to each segment. However, the documentation from Untangle on how to configure DHCP options, is a bit This video shows you how to setup dnsmasq on a Raspberry Pi to assign your network devices static IPs even though they still use DHCP to get their addresses. The main advantage to using it is to speed up the resolution of local hostnames. Depending on the segment and use case your firewall I know this is a non-standard setup and a multi-disciplinary request, but I'm trying to get my PiHole to serve DHCP addresses (and, after that's working, resolve / block DNS queries) on multiple subnets [USG] DHCP client hostname DNS registration improvements - strip invalid characters and register the remaining, and allow periods. 49. Additional Considerations DHCP DNS Option: If you're using the Dnsmasq is a lightweight network server providing DNS, DHCP, TFTP, and PXE functions. We can configure the DNS server, and add local DNS records. hosts. NOTES & REQUIREMENTS: Applicable to the latest EdgeOS "One of the main advantages to using dnsmasq for DHCP is the ease of resolving local hostnames. Click Apply Changes. lan and our AD server will be dc. Removed 'host-decl The commands below should be run on the USG CLI and will disable the resolv. Another benefit of using local DNS forwarding in EdgeOS is the option to resolve local hostnames easily when also using dnsmasq for DHCP. lan with IP 10. well, ok, I found it a little surprising First, a little background in case you're unaware what dnsmasq is: It's a I usually configure the DHCP server to pass option 43 with the IP of the Unifi Controller (which sits on the Internet). Hence I could not use ISC DHCP server for DHCPv6 either (?). Configure UniFi Devices: Point your UniFi devices to use this local DNS . Set the DHCP server to use "One of the main advantages to using dnsmasq for DHCP is the ease of resolving local hostnames. This article will give instructions on how to enable dnsmasq for DHCP on an EdgeRouter and explains the UniFi client names and IPs will be written to /etc/dnsmasq. d/unifi. If you want to use ISC DHCP, you could : Enable the ipv6 > router-advert Script to bring static DNS to Unifi UXG. Remember: One of the neat and relatively undocumented feature of Unifi Security Gateway (USG) is the ability to specify alternate DNS servers sent with DHCP replies for specific clients, permitting you to do things Since some of the existing DHCP server config settings are specific to the ISC DHCP implementation (e. conf This article explains how to configure DHCP Option 43 for Unifi L3 adoption across various network setups like pfSense and Mikrotik, including HEX conversion true Hey Guys, I've been using Unifi APs for years, but just got my first USG for my house. The Interface is Using dnsmasq's DHCP server in a docker container to provide a network with static IP address allocation based on MAC addresses. 10. Although there are several ways to use NextDNS in the context of a home network, I found that the most reliable and the best way So I did a quick search for dnsmasq here and found nothing, which shocked and awed me. Enable Local DNS Record and enter a hostname. Additional Considerations DHCP DNS Option: If you're using the Apply Changes: After entering your preferred DNS servers, click on 'Save' to apply the changes. dnsmasq will look in /etc/dnsmasq. With it you can define custom DNS A records: You can also define 5. (For trusted and semi-trusted networks). derpanet. DHCP configured with the device IP for DNS. Add DNS Server IPs: Here, This setting will ease the discovery and adoption of UniFi devices and is useful when the application is located on a different subnet. DNS Masq is a great little DNS and DHCP combo server built into most DDWRT images, and available in most Linux distributions. Today I got fed up and decided to do In UniFi Network, we have two options when it comes to configuring DNS. Contribute to StoneLabs/unifi-uxg-dnsmasq development by creating an account on GitHub. If you have a busy Please follow the below template, it will help us to help you! Expected Behaviour: IP of Unifi controller is set using DHCP option 43 Actual Behaviour: No parameter set using option 43. I’ve historically run dnsmasq on like a raspberry pi or mini pc. To add the option to an As I’m preparing to take the plunge from DD-WRT to a Ubiquiti UniFi setup, one of the necessary steps was an alternative DNS server that I could integrate with The dhcp-range set:<tag> directive effectively creates a DHCP server context within dnsmasq, which can then be referenced explicitly by other settings prefixed with using tag:<tagvalue> I have a UDM Pro and a Unifi AP. This provides a crude, but effective method of Step 2 Type configure when prompted to enter configuration mode. This is explained DHCP options DHCP options can be configured under the DHCP pool section via dhcp_option. The DHCP Server on UniFi Gateways dynamically assigns IP addresses to devices and provides other information such as the location of the default gateway and Ubiquiti (unifi devices) uses option 43 (sub-option 1) to send the IP address of the unifi controller to devices to enable L3 adoption. Throughout the example our AD domain will be called derpanet. Type set service dhcp-server use-dnsmasq enable and then commit, save and exit Long story short, just like Pepperidge Farm remembers, so does my Unifi Security Gateway (DHCP and DNS server). Full step-by-step included. - cdchris12/UDM-DNS-Fix It then builds a custom dns-alias. My issue is this, when I How do I set option 66 when using dnsmasq as my DHCP-server on an ERL3? I've enabled dnsmasq instead DHCPD as follows: I added the server address in the options for dnsmasq: And for good This is particularly useful if your UniFi gateway uses a frequently changing WAN IP as a result of DHCP assignment. Make a DHCP “Set” rule Now in OPNsense go (again) to: Services-Dnsmasq DNS & DHCP-DHCP options and press the + to add a value. , the failover settings, the “free-form” parameters settings), those will be ignored when use If you do want to use cleanbrowsing. Relying on a dynamic WAN IP to facilitate Overview Readers will learn how to add custom options to the DHCP server configuration. Please see the Related Articles below for Readers will learn how to enable the Dnsmasq feature on the EdgeRouter's DHCP server. 0 EdgeOS firmware and higher on all EdgeRouter models. conf file, copies it to the UDM Pro (not the UniFi controller; there's a difference), then restarts the dnsmasq service. Today I got fed up and decided to do Step 2 Type configure when prompted to enter configuration mode. g. hosts for dnsmasq. I was a bit disappointed to discover how cumbersome it is to create DNS entries for servers on my local I realized that setting hostname in the console UI basically sets a dns record for them for the router when it’s your dns server via dhcp. Created 43-unifi. 65. d and read *. This article will give instructions on how to enable dnsmasq for DHCP on an EdgeRouter and explains the Configure DHCP settings Scroll to DHCP Name Server: In the network settings, scroll down to the "DHCP Name Server" section. If you use an unifi device as your DHCP server, it’ll be DNSmasq for DHCP can be used as an alternative to ISC DHCPD as the backend for the EdgeRouter. #dhcp-rapid-commit # Run an executable All VLANs were set up to use UniFi for DHCP, but were pointing at Pi-hole for DNS. . This DHCP transition and decoupling took some effort due to the various moving ISP - All in One ESXi server - ICX6610 (via two 40GBe connections) - Unifi APs The ESXi server runs a firewall (now ClearOS, but I tried pfsense), Ubuntu, Solaris for file server. hosts files as additional host files, Enable Fixed IP Address to set a DHCP reservation for this or another IP. If you use an unifi device as your DHCP server, it’ll be automatically This must only be enabled if either the server is # the only server for the subnet, or multiple servers are present and they each # commit a binding for all clients. org or opendns familyshield (which I use), just set that up on your internet connection as dns server overrides, and let each dhcp pool on each network use automatic A simple script to provide basic DHCP hostname resolution in the latest UniFi Dream Machine Pro firmware. 6vmh1k, j4ti, kc9n, nnnzqy, gepk, v6dgp, ah4b, yq1ig, s6d1h6, ucac,